Why PayID Matters for Australian Online Pokies Players
With the rise of digital payment options, the way Australians fund their online pokies sessions has evolved dramatically. PayID is one of the newer methods gaining traction, promising quick and fuss-free deposits that suit the fast-paced nature of online gaming. This system links a simple identifier like a phone number or email to a bank account, allowing instantaneous transfers without the usual delays associated with traditional payment methods. The advantage here is not just speed but also security. Banks across Australia support PayID, which uses the New Payments Platform (NPP) infrastructure designed to facilitate immediate payments. This means deposits made into online pokies accounts are reflected almost instantly, eliminating one of the biggest frustrations players faced before: waiting hours or even days for funds to clear.
How PayID Stands Against Other Payment Methods
Comparing PayID to traditional options like credit cards or e-wallets reveals some interesting contrasts. Credit card transactions can sometimes take a while to process and may involve additional fees or security checks. E-wallets, while faster, require extra setup and management of a separate account. PayID reduces those steps to a minimum, relying on your existing bank details without the need for third-party apps.

Security and Regulation in Australian Online Gambling Payments
Security is a top priority when handling money online, especially in gambling. PayID operates under the oversight of Australia’s banking regulatory frameworks, ensuring that your payments are protected by advanced encryption and fraud prevention measures. The New Payments Platform underpinning PayID transactions is monitored closely to maintain high standards.
